Picture-perfect Sykesville is rich with history and surrounded by natural beauty. The heart of the city is its quaint, historic downtown, which is home to beautiful, historic buildings filled with boutiques, cafes, and specialty shops. Sykesville was even named one of the "Coolest Small Towns in America" by Budget Travel Magazine in 2016 -- and it lives up to its title. Just peruse the downtown shops and restaurants (start your day off with a crepe and coffee at the French Twist) and the community vibe, friendly shop owners, and colorfully-painted buildings will inspire you.

What Are Walk Score®, Transit Score®, and Bike Score® Ratings?
Walk Score® measures the walkability of any address. Transit Score® measures access to public transit. Bike Score® measures the bikeability of any address.
What is a Sound Score Rating?
A Sound Score Rating aggregates noise caused by vehicle traffic, airplane traffic and local sources
